What I Looked for Before Buying
Before making a decision, I focused on a few key things:
- Battery life: I wanted enough runtime to finish my yard work without constant recharging.
- Weight and comfort: I preferred a blower that I could use for a longer time without tiring my arms.
- Air power: I needed decent blowing strength for leaves, grass clippings, and light debris.
- Ease of use: I valued simple controls and quick setup.
- Noise level: I liked the idea of a quieter blower compared to gas models.

What I Would Keep in Mind Before Buying
Even though I like cordless blowers, I would still keep a few things in mind:
- I would check whether the battery is included.
- I would compare runtime with my yard size.
- I would make sure the airflow is strong enough for my needs.
- I would look at customer feedback about durability.
These details matter to me because they help me avoid disappointment after purchase.
